PEDESTAL CHANGE
I have a 97 E-350 7.3 that the valve in the pedestal is leaking and have not been able to fine a new valve except from ford high$$$$$ i have been told that I could take the valve out and plug the hole with a tap and do away with it all together as it will not make a lot of difference in Arkansas were I live. What effect is this going to have on it? I've read some threads where guys have talked about putting pedestal on that do not have this valve. Any comments greatly appreciated.

pedestal change
I went down to Brian's and they welded the two oil inlet holes inside and i am going to plug the actuator rod hole with a pipe plug after i tap the hole. Then I am going to fix the ebpv open or take the valve out completely.
